H.R. 3147 (103rd)

To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to make the targeted jobs credit permanent and to treat as a member of a targeted group every individual who has received a Department of Defense campaign ribbon, liberation ribbon, or national defense service medal.

Summary

Amends the Internal Revenue Code to make the targeted jobs credit permanent law. Treats as a member of a targeted group a conflict-era veteran who has been awarded a campaign ribbon, liberation ribbon, or national defense service medal by the Department of Defense.
